We are looking for a System Tester to join our team and take part in the verification and validation of complex aviation systems within a multidisciplinary development environment, located in Haifa.

 

 

Responsibilities

 

  • Execute system-level tests based on system and specification documents
  • Write and maintain system test procedures and test cases
  • Document, track, and manage defects throughout the development lifecycle
  • Collaborate with system engineers and development teams to investigate issues and support resolution
  • Analyze test results and ensure system compliance with defined requirements

 

 

Requirements

 

  • Ability to maintain a broad, system-level perspective during system testing activities
  • Basic ability to read, analyze, and understand system and operational requirements, and to derive test procedures accordingly
  • Familiarity with Quality Center or similar defect tracking and configuration management tools
  • Basic experience or academic exposure to system testing and support of complex systems, preferably in defense or precision-guided munition environments
  • Ability to execute & analyze manual system-level test procedures, to assist in investigation and issue resolution
